Wiktionary
drop-downnoun
A type of menu that, when selected, opens downward to reveal a list of possible options.
The choice you want should be somewhere in that drop-down.
drop-downadjective
Of a computer menu, opening downward to reveal a list of possible options.
Make your selection from the drop-down list.
